Output 32eeaf25039066bd29441c956829f5ed8e69e77519a6c6c9a9eb1c2777a2834c:0

value
515083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e38e125ca2cc7ec8ecc2e766e44c0904304d228 OP_EQUAL
address
35uR9RXc5TUwtAfo9XhQSMPpiKfZHuFHtH
transaction
32eeaf25039066bd29441c956829f5ed8e69e77519a6c6c9a9eb1c2777a2834c
spent
true